Wright tossed three scoreless innings in Monday's win over the Mets, WEEI.com reports. He surrendered two hits and a walk. Wright said he's feeling much better this spring compared to 2014 when he entered training camp after having undergone sports hernia surgery. Joe Kelly developed some biceps soreness Monday, which gets us to thinking about Boston's starting depth. Wright is probably the first in line for an emergency start if manager John Farrell needs to reach down to Triple-A Pawtucket.
